Examples of homology or evolutionary analogy
Are the limbs modified in the wings of bats and wings of bird’s examples of homology or evolutionary analogy? What about whale fins compared to the fish fins?
Expert
Bat and bird wings have the similar function and the similar origin (they are modified in limbs) so they are homologous and analogous organs. Whale fins are a modification of posterior limbs while fish fins though having the similar function don’t come from modified limbs; so they are analogous however not homologous structures.
Evolutionary homology suggests general ancestry while biological analogy relates to concept of the evolutionary convergence, the appearance of same aspects in evolutionarily distant species which explore the similar type of environment (in the mentioned case, aquatic habitat).
